Via del Mare Astigiano (VMA)

da Isola d'Asti a Montegrosso d'Asti (61,80 km)

Highlights and tour details

The Via del Mare Astigiano proposes itself as an itinerary through territories that were and still are strongly characterised by water. These are territories that markedly shared the presence of water in the past, whose history has been considerably expanded over the years through the surfacing of finds, the study of morphology and existing vegetation. The itinerary is based on the ridges which include routes already included in the regional hiking network. Within the route there are also several points of historical and cultural interest represented by significant historical centres and related architecture of mainly medieval origin but with Baroque extensions, such as the Castle of Costigliole, but also more ancient traces of Roman times such as the historical roads of Montegrosso.
